Founding of the Pre-Raphaelite Brotherhood

Founding · 1848

Seven young artists and writers, led by Dante Gabriel Rossetti, William Holman Hunt and John Everett Millais, formed a secret brotherhood pledged to reject the academic formulas descended from Raphael and return to the bright color and moral seriousness of early Italian art. They signed their canvases with the cryptic initials PRB.

Britain's first organized avant-garde: its medievalism and truth-to-nature creed shaped Victorian painting, the Aesthetic movement and the Arts and Crafts generation.
